About HDFC Bank Ltd
HDFC Bank was established in 1994 and is head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ra. Since its inception, the bank has grown rapidly and today serves millions of customers across India.
Key Highlights:
-
Founded: 1994
-
Head Office: Mumbai, Maharashtra
-
Bank Type: Private Sector Bank
-
Services Offered:
-
Retail & Corporate Banking
-
Loans and Credit Facilities
-
Insurance & Investment Products
-
Internet & Mobile Banking
-
With thousands of branches and ATMs across India, HDFC Bank provides employment opportunities in almost every region of the country.

Selection Process
The recruitment process at HDFC Bank generally includes:
-
Application Screening
-
Online Aptitude / Written Test (for some roles)
-
Group Discussion (mainly for officer positions)
-
Personal Interview (HR & Technical)
-
Final Offer & Joining
The exact process may differ depending on the position.
Career Growth at HDFC Bank
HDFC Bank follows a structured promotion policy that allows employees to move into higher roles based on performance and experience.
Example Career Paths:
-
Sales Executive → Relationship Manager → Branch Manager → Regional Head
-
Clerk → Officer → Assistant Manager → Manager → Senior Manager
Employees also benefit from certifications, leadership programs, and regular performance reviews.
Salary Package at HDFC Bank (Indicative)
| Job Role | Approx. Monthly Salary |
|---|---|
| Clerk | ₹20,000 – ₹25,000 |
| Probationary Officer | ₹35,000 – ₹45,000 |
| Relationship Manager | ₹30,000 – ₹50,000 |
| Sales Executive | ₹15,000 – ₹22,000 + incentives |
| IT Officer | ₹40,000 – ₹60,000 |
(Salary figures may vary by role, location, and experience.)
